Mega Millions Megaplier increases the value of any non-jackpot prizes by 2x, 3x, 4x, or 5x. This supplementary feature is offered in most states and it costs an additional $1. You must opt in when you play your numbers for the main game, you cannot add it to your ticket at a later date.

The Megaplier is randomly picked before the main draw. It is drawn from a set of 15 balls. Five of these are marked ‘2X’, six balls with ‘3X’, three balls with ‘4X’ and only one ball with ‘5X’.
